Askin Knocks Out Kellet in First Round

Here’s a news snippet from Manchester’s Evening News Website.

And last of the Collyhurst winning trio was Matty Askin who fought the robust Lee Kellet from Barrow-in-Furness.

Askin, a 19-year-old heavyweight, was going for his seventh successive victory.

And Hughes said: “He was another who boxed to perfection.”

Askin floored Kellet for a count of eight and, while still wobbling, the Barrow fighter walked straight into another one-two combination with Askin finishing with a short powerful left hook that saw Kellet drop.

He lay on the floor with the doctor and paramedics giving him oxygen and attention but recovered.

“Matty is a good prospect,” added Hughes. “He needs more fights and experience then he will improve a great deal.”
